Russian base shelled in Dagestan

Separatists with assault rifles and a rocket launcher

A Russian Military base in Dagestan has come under mortar and grenade attack.

The incident occurred at a military base in the town of Khunzahk. According to a representative from the Ministry of Internal Affairs, the base was attacked by unknown gunmen using rocket and grenade launchers in the early hours of the morning. The representative said that there had been no casualties but that the attacks damaged several buildings and resulted in a fire within the compound. The fire has since been contained.

The gunmen, most likely separatist rebels, managed to escape.
